September 19, 2019 Opinion or Order Filing 4 ORDER: Before the court is the appellants request for transcripts, forwarded by the district court on 09/18/2019. This appeal is subject to the Prison Litigation Reform Act and therefore all proceedings are suspended pending the assessment and payment of any necessary fees. See Newlin v. Helman, 123 F.3d 429, 434 (7th Cir. 1997). A review of the docket indicates that the appellant's fee status has not yet been determined. Accordingly, IT IS ORDERED that any relief requested in the appellants filing is DENIED without court action, pursuant to this court's fee notice and order dated 09/04/2019. Further, the appellant is reminded that he must either pay the $505.00 filing fee in the district court or file a motion for leave to proceed on appeal in forma pauperis and a PLRA memorandum in support with the clerk of this court by 10/17/2019.
